Did you realize your conviction or arrest in Miami Dade County, Florida may later be removed from your record? Expungement is the legal process by which a criminal record is either sealed or destroyed after a certain period of time has lapsed. If your record has been expunged, you may be able to apply for a job without reporting a prior criminal conviction.

Miami Dade County Expungement Procedures

Generally expunging your record involves procuring court documents detailing your original case, and then filing the proper paperwork with courts in Miami Dade County, Florida

Nonetheless, not every state allows expungment, nor is every crime capable of being expunged. This process can be complicated depending upon your past history with law enforcement and prior convictions.
